Forfeiture of Federal Pensions for False Statements to Congress

This bill aims to strip federal employees of their retirement benefits if they are convicted of making false statements under oath to Congress. This applies when the false statements are related to their official duties and made after the law's enactment. The goal is to increase accountability for public officials.
Key points
Federal employees may lose their retirement benefits if convicted of making false statements to Congress.
This applies only to false statements made after the law's enactment and related to official duties.
The bill also covers employees of the U.S. Postal Service and Postal Regulatory Commission.
